GoPlus: Beware of Google Search Clade Code top results/ads as malicious installers
Mar 11, 2026 11:40:23
According to the security alert released by GoPlus, attackers are using Google search ads to deploy malware that is a pixel-perfect clone of the official #Claude Code installation page. This malware steals user passwords, cookies, session tokens, crypto wallets, credentials, and system information.
GoPlus recommends identifying the ad labels in search results, carefully checking the subtle differences in URLs compared to the official website; verifying installation methods through multiple channels such as official documentation, social media, or GitHub repositories; not executing unfamiliar commands directly and analyzing command behavior before running; and installing security plugins to intercept phishing links, risky signatures, authorizations, and transactions in real-time.
